探索计算机视觉领域的人脸识别技术

晨曦微光 2024-01-04 ⋅ 24 阅读

在计算机视觉领域中,人脸识别技术是一项引人注目且备受关注的研究方向。随着计算机处理能力的提升和深度学习算法的革命性发展,人脸识别技术在各个领域的应用越来越广泛,从安全领域的人脸解锁到市场营销领域的人群分析,其应用场景多种多样。

基本原理

人脸识别技术的基本原理是通过计算机对输入的图像或视频中的人脸进行检测、识别和验证。它主要包括以下几个步骤:

  1. 人脸检测:通过一系列的图像处理和特征提取算法,将输入图像中的人脸区域提取出来。
  2. 人脸对齐:对提取出来的人脸区域进行标准化和对齐,使得后续的特征提取更加准确。
  3. 特征提取:使用深度学习算法从人脸图像中提取出一组特征向量,用于表示该人脸的唯一身份特征。
  4. 特征匹配:将提取出来的特征向量与已有的特征库进行比对,找出最相似的人脸特征。
  5. 人脸识别:根据特征匹配的结果,判断输入图像中的人脸是否属于已知的某个身份。

技术挑战

人脸识别技术面临着一些技术挑战,包括:

  1. 变化因素:人脸在不同光照、表情、角度、遮挡等情况下都可能发生变化,这对于人脸识别的准确性产生了挑战。
  2. 大规模数据库:随着人脸识别技术的应用范围扩大,需要处理非常大规模的人脸数据库,这对算法的效率和可扩展性提出了要求。
  3. 隐私问题:人脸识别技术的广泛应用也引发了隐私问题的关注,如何保护个人的隐私成为了一个重要的问题。

应用领域

人脸识别技术在各个领域得到了广泛应用,包括但不限于:

  1. 安全领域:人脸解锁、无人脸门禁、刷脸支付等,提供了更加方便和安全的身份验证方式。
  2. 市场营销:通过人脸识别技术进行人群分析,了解顾客的年龄、性别、情绪等信息,帮助商家做出更精准的营销策略。
  3. 智能监控:人脸识别技术可以辅助智能监控系统对可疑人员进行识别和报警,提高社会安全性。
  4. 医疗领域:人脸识别技术可以用于病人的身份验证和医疗数据的访问权限控制,改善医疗管理效率。
  5. 教育领域:学校可以通过人脸识别技术管理学生考勤、安全出入等问题,提高教育质量。

发展趋势

未来,随着计算机硬件和算法的不断进步,人脸识别技术将更加精确、高效和安全。以下是一些可能的发展趋势:

  1. 多模态融合:将人脸识别与声纹、指纹等其他生物特征相结合,实现多模态融合的身份认证技术。
  2. 三维人脸识别:使用深度摄像头捕捉人脸的三维信息,提高对立体场景下的人脸识别精度。
  3. 弱监督学习:通过利用更少的标注数据进行训练,提高人脸识别算法的泛化能力和鲁棒性。
  4. 隐私保护:研究如何使用加密技术、匿名化等方法对人脸数据进行保护,实现隐私友好型的人脸识别技术。

总结起来,计算机视觉领域的人脸识别技术在应用方面有着广阔的前景。随着技术的不断革新和进步,我们可以期待更加高效、精确和安全的人脸识别解决方案的出现,助力各个行业的发展。


全部评论: 0

    我有话说: